I was looking on Ebay and advertised is a mirror that incorporates the sunvisor rod insert bracket.

http://www.ebay.com/itm/Vintage-Original-1967-1968-1969-1973-Ford-Mustang-Rear-View-Mirror-/272339580860?hash=item3f68b437bc:g:EBYAAOSwKfVXIpF1&vxp=mtr

My car has a individual bracket for the sunvisor rods. The mirror is laying on my passenger seat unattached from the windshield.

So my question; Is the mirror on Ebay correct for my 1971 Grande?

If the Ebay mirror is incorrect & the mirror is glued directly to the screen does the mirror have a slot in the back that slides into a bracket and the bracket glues directly to the windshield?

If the Ebay one is incorrect where can i purchase a correct mirror used or NOS?

Can someone post a picture of a correct mirror please

The Ebay mirror is not correct for the 1971-73 Mustangs. The 71-73 Mustangs had the mirror glued onto the actual windshield. I will have to find my mirror for my 73 Grande' for pictures if no one else puts one up for you. It's in one of the many boxes of parts I have as I took my car apart for restoration 4 years ago.
